数据库909196179.ppt

  1. 1、本文档共7页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
数据库909196179

请用你认为最清晰简洁的方式归纳介绍这一章中的主要内容(特别是要理清1.2节中所描述的几种模型之间的关系,重点理解关系模型中的相关概念) * 在这章中,书本介绍了数据库的几个最基本的,同样也是最重要的概念。 在1.1节中,包括什么是数据,数据管理,数据库(DB),数据库管理系统(DBMS),还简单介绍了数据管理技术的产生与发展以及数据库的应用。 在1.2节中,着重介绍了数据模型,涉及的概念有数据模型(概念模型、逻辑模型、物理模型),数据的完整性约束条件,还介绍了数据库产生以来的几种数据模型,包括层模型、网状模次型、关系模型、现代的主流——面向对象模型、XML模型、XPath 1.0数据模型以及XQuery 1.0和XPath 2.0。主要介绍了关系模型和面向对象模型。 在1.3节中,主要介绍了数据抽象和数据库的三级模式。还有在三级模式中涉及的两层映像和数据独立性。 在1.4节中,详细介绍了数据库系统,即数据库。包括数据库的组成,数据库管理系统(DBMS的功能,组成,DBMS的查询处理器,存储管理器),还介绍了与数据库系统的相关人员。 1.2节中所描述的几种模型之间的关系。 现实世界 将现实世界中 的实体抽象化 概念模型 DBMS支持的逻辑模型 DBMS支持的物理模型 由数据库设计人员完成 可以由数据库设计人员完成,也可以 用数据库设计工具协助设计人员完成 一般由DBMS完成 1.2.5 关系模型中的相关概念 1.关系(relation):一个关系对应一张二维表,每个关系都有一个关系名。 2.元组(tuple):表中的一行称为一个元组。 3.属性(attribute):表中的一列称为一个属性,每个属性均有一个属性名。 4.码(key):也成为码键,表中的某个属性或属性组,它可以唯一地确定关系中的一个元组。 5.域(domain):属性的取值范围。 6.分量(component):元组的一个属性值。 7.关系模型(relational schema):通过关系名和属性名表对关系进行描述,相当于二维表的表头部分(即表格描述部分),一般形式为 关系名(属性名1,属性名2,。。。属性名n) 用实例来理解以上概念 还有域的概念:比如,上图中的性别只能取男和女,也就是该属性的取值范围了。 人们为什么要关注数据库管理技术?哪些人需要了解甚至是深谙数据库技术? 20世纪60年代以来,数据管理对象的规模越来越大,应用范围越来越广。由于计算机技术的发展,为了解决多用户、多应用共享数据的需求,数据库应运而生。发展到如今,数据库已经深入人们生活的方方面面,只要你访问网络,几乎时时刻刻和数据库打交道,数据库可以说已经成为人们生活不可或缺的一部分。 由于Web用户界面隐藏了访问数据库的细节,单纯的数据库的用户对数据库的了解可以不用很深入。但是,对于数据库的了解,几乎就是人人都需要了。而以下一些人就需要深谙数据库技术了。 1数据库管理员。 2系统分析员和数据库设计人员。 3应用程序员。 *

文档评论(0)

ligennv1314 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档